Kansas Archbishop Heartbroken After Beloved Priest Killed Outside His Home

In a shocking and tragic incident, a beloved Kansas priest was found dead outside his home, leaving the local Catholic community devastated and searching for answers. Archbishop Joseph F. Naumann of the Archdiocese of Kansas City has publicly mourned the loss, calling the priest a "faithful servant of God" whose life was cut short in an unthinkable act of violence.

A Community in Mourning

The priest, whose name has not yet been released pending family notification, was discovered outside his residence early Thursday morning. Authorities have not disclosed the exact cause of death, but foul play is suspected.

  • Dedicated Service: The priest had served for over 15 years in the Kansas City area, known for his compassion and commitment to social justice.
  • Archbishop’s Statement: Archbishop Naumann described him as "a man of deep faith who touched countless lives through his ministry."
  • Ongoing Investigation: Local law enforcement is working closely with church officials while urging anyone with information to come forward.

Impact on the Faithful

Parishioners gathered for a spontaneous prayer vigil, sharing tearful memories of a priest who was more than a spiritual leader—he was a friend. "He was always there for us, no matter the hour," said one longtime church member.
